PRAW-TEWS(Classical Greek) PRO-tee-əs(English) [key·IPA] Meaning & History Derived from Greek πρῶτος (protos) meaning "first". In Greek mythology this was the name of a prophetic god of the sea. Shakespeare later utilized it for a character in his play The Two Gentlemen of Verona (1594).
